Limestone Wall Panels: Elegant & Functional

Limestone wall panels are ideal for exterior applications where you want a seamless, clean, and modern look. These panels are precisely cut and installed to create a smooth surface that enhances architectural lines and adds a sense of uniformity to the design.

  • Perfect for high-rise buildings and luxury villas

  • Available in multiple finishes: honed, brushed, or sandblasted

  • Resistant to moisture and temperature fluctuations


Limestone Paving for Patios: Redefine Outdoor Living

If you want to create inviting and stylish outdoor spaces, limestone paving for patios is an excellent option. Its natural slip-resistant surface makes it both safe and practical for gardens, courtyards, pool areas, and walkways.

Why It Stands Out:

  • Beautiful earthy tones complement landscaping

  • Withstands heavy foot traffic and weather conditions

  • Easy to maintain and clean
